My plumbing career kicked off in 1985. In 1989, I founded my plumbing business. I specialized in plumbing systems for new builds. This includes water, gas, drains, and vents.
Over the years, I transitioned to service and repair. I primarily work on residential plumbing, such as water heating systems, fixtures, drainage, and sewer lines.
I possess a rich history in plumbing repairs and services. I am a proficient problem solver. I maintain a friendly demeanor with clients.
